I have a 2013 road king standard I want to cut down the heat from the pipes? can I wrap them with header wrap

I wouldn't personally. Apart from being darned ugly you won't solve the problem at source. If your bike is bone stock you can improve the heat problem by going to stage 1, removing the cat and adding a tuner, to adjust fuelling. Stacks of stuff in here on the subject! Here is one worth reading.
